Xavier, Juelz & Pete complete marathon 27-hour broadcast

Staff Writer

Hit92.9’s new Breakfast show were tasked with a big challenge last week, completing a 27-hour non-stop broadcast.

Xavier, Juelz & Pete wanted to show listeners the kind of fun they would be bringing to the show in 2020, so after going live at 6am Thursday, they went all the way through to 9am Friday.

I feel like an empty shell, but I can’t tell you how rewarding it is to broadcast for 27 hours straight with my two best friends, knowing we’re 27 hours stronger,” said Pete.

Over the 27-hour period, they Xavier dedicated a full day to Juelz’s tinder profile, eventually securing a candlelit dinner date later in the evening.

Xavier, Juelz & Pete all left the studio to broadcast from the Scarborough Sunset Markets with thousands of Perth’s beachgoers, and later into Claremont at midnight to shout kebabs to the nightclubbers heading home.

They were joined by a stacked lineup of guests too, including Birds of Toyko’s Ian Kenny; Perth Wild Cats captain, Damian Martin; West Coast Eagles captain, Luke Shuey; Fremantle Dockers’ Luke Ryan; Pete’s mum (with food!); two alpacas; and of course, Juelz’s Tinder date, Josh.
